Early day motion · EDM 504 · 20 Feb 1991

RETIRED MINERS AND WIDOWS LUMP SUM PAYMENTS

Tabled by Alex Eadie (Labour) 112 signatures

The motion

That this House calls on the Secretary of State for Social Security to treat lump sum payments, accepted by retired miners and their widows in commutation of their cash in lieu rights, under the capital rules, to bring an end to the ludicrous state of affairs where the adjudicating authority is likely to decide, in such cases, that a person opting for a lump sum payment has deprived themselves of a regular income for the purposes of obtaining benefit and consequently is to be deemed as if they are still in receipt of that income.
